Portuguese term or phrase: canapés
This term is used in Menus from restaurants
Heloisa
canapés
Explanation:
Like many French culinary terms, canapés is perfectly acceptable in English, and in some situations more appropriate than appetizers.

22 mins   confidence: Answerer confidence 5/5 peer agreement (net): +2
canapés


Explanation:
This French term is used in English and needs no translation (see Oxford Dic, and Google )

--------------------------------------------------
Note added at 2004-11-17 12:43:24 (GMT)
--------------------------------------------------

Isabel - your answer wasnt there when I put forward mine:) \"Appetizer\" is a more general term covering any small amount of food or drink before a meal, whereas canapés are, specifically, small pieces of bread or pastry with a savoury on top.
